Transaction 64768d25c97e78beb079749449f5839ceed1bddfd8a8401c895d0de89f1ac6d0

2 Input
2 Outputs
  • 64768d25c97e78beb079749449f5839ceed1bddfd8a8401c895d0de89f1ac6d0:0
  • value  999316
    address  3CEBRJPMi3W8CE69hw4eHAw76z2V5xUcBE
  • 64768d25c97e78beb079749449f5839ceed1bddfd8a8401c895d0de89f1ac6d0:1
  • value  7670195
    address  3GxGkCaqzcoWxFCBt4GNdQ381WN96Thkhr